Purpose.
To define baseline naval forces, strike groups, and other major deployable elements as they pertain to expeditionary strike forces, carrier strike groups, expeditionary strike groups, and surface strike groups. The terms and policy described in this instruction do not imply command relationships other than describing the Fleet organizational baseline required to accomplish the range of military operations in support of Combatant Commanders and Navy Component Commanders missions and demand signals. While this instruction provides the units that describe a baseline expeditionary strike force, carrier strike group, expeditionary strike group, and surface strike group, global force providers and Navy Component Commanders can tailor (based on the availability of units) these adaptable force packages to meet specific combatant commander missions.
